The tomtoc Armor Case for Steam Deck/OLED is a hard shell, slim, and portable travel case designed for superior protection and convenience. Made from military-grade materials, it ensures your device is safe from impacts and shocks while allowing easy access for charging. With a sleek design and user-friendly features, this case is perfect for gamers on the go.
Shell Type | Hard |
Material Type | Case |
Color | Black |
Item Dimensions L x W x H | 12.05"L x 5.59"W x 2.36"H |
Closure Type | Push Lock |
Compatible Devices | Steam Deck/ Steam Deck OLED |

so close to perfect for my use
The Tomtoc Steam Deck case offers excellent protection in a sleek, hard-shell design. Its solid plastic exterior provides a robust barrier against impacts and scratches, giving me confidence that my Deck is safe during transport. The case fits the Steam Deck snugly, preventing it from rattling around, and the quality of the materials is evident. I appreciate the secure clasp mechanism and the precise molding that cradles the device. Inside, the fitted interior securely holds the Steam Deck, minimizing any movement. Unlike some other cases, like the DBRAND, the Tomtoc is completely removed when using the Steam Deck, meaning there's absolutely no added bulk during gameplay.One minor drawback is the lack of ventilation holes. While this contributes to the case's overall protective capabilities, it can lead to some heat buildup during demanding tasks, especially when I'm away from home. On occasion, this has caused my Steam Deck to go into standby mode. While this hasn't been a major issue, some added ventilation would be a welcome improvement. Despite this, the peace of mind knowing my Steam Deck is well-protected when not in use makes the Tomtoc case a great choice. If you're looking for a durable, hard-shell case that prioritizes protection and offers a completely unencumbered experience during gameplay, the Tomtoc is definitely worth considering.

Does its job, be careful opening!
The case included with my steam deck is too large to stuff in my small backpack, and I didn't want to risk damaging the joysticks on my deck, so I grabbed this to keep the volume down while still keeping some protection for the joysticks/buttons. The size is perfect to tetris my 100Wh portable power bank between the handles so that it takes up minimal room in my bag.It's nice that you can plug the deck in to charge while the case is closed, but be careful opening the case with a cable plugged in, as it will pinch the cable and this could damage your deck's Type-C port. A bigger notch cutout would still provide protection for the deck's screen and could prevent this issue. (Alternatively, just don't be a clumsy oaf like me.)I also kinda wish there were some cutouts for the vents, that way I could keep the deck plugged in and charging while it was on/doing updates, but hey, this thing does its job.As a bonus, when opened up, unfolded, and with the deck removed, it's the perfect size to act as a lap-protector for my 14 inch gaming laptop, keeping the bottom vents nice and clear while resting on my legs. Didn't expect this extra benefit, but I'll take it!Overall a good product, would recommend to others.

Great case but may have an achilles heal (or 2).
The media could not be loaded. I love this case and its the only one I use now. Its also the only SD case that will fit in my Fjallraven Ulvo L hip pack, including vs other slim tom-toc cases which I tried. It hs a couple flaws though:1.) is they made the plastic SO close to the screen that in the center 2 square inches or so you can press it in and slightly tap the screen. So potentially a very hard direct hit from something right in the center could, possibly crack the screen. I don’t worry about it as I always have my battery pack blocking it anyway and it fits perfectly over the screen. Tomtoc could easily have raised it another 5mm and it wouldn’t compromise the slimness as the joystick covers protrude up like an entire inch anyway.2.) Secondly the clasp folds in far enough when open that it touches the bottom 1/6 inch of screen, so if you were to quickly close it not realizing the clasp was pushed in you could possibly crack your screen that way.Would love to see these issues addressed in a V.2.Otherwise I love it, and despite these two minor flaws its the only case that fits my bag. I love the open charging port so I can charge it while in the case too.
